Immunoglobulin A vasculitis and Kawasaki disease management in children

The term vasculitis refers to inflammation directed at blood vessels of any size, which leads to destruction of the vessel wall. Vasculitis represent a heterogeneous group of conditions with varied pathogenesis, clinical presentation and histopathologic features.
